Hon’ble Supreme Court has dismissed the appeal field by Resolution Professional against the NCLAT order in Giriraj Enterprises Vs. Regen Powertech Pvt. Ltd. (2023) ibclaw.in 569 NCLAT and has held that the Resolution Professional should not have filed the present appeals. The Resolution Professional should have maintained a neutral stand. It is for the aggrieved parties, including the Committee of Creditors of Regen Powertech Private Limited (RPPL) and Regen Infrastructure and Services Private Limited (RISPL), to take appropriate proceedings or file an appeal before this Court. Recording the aforesaid, the present appeals preferred by the Resolution Professional are dismissed as not entertained. If required and necessary, the Court can take assistance and ascertain the facts from the Resolution Professional, in case an appeal(s) is preferred by the Committee of Creditors or a third party.

IN THE SUPREME COURT OF INDIA

Regen Powertech Pvt. Ltd.
v.
Giriraj Enterprises & Anr.

Civil Appeal Nos. 5985-6001 of 2023
Decided on 25-Sep-23

Coram: Mr. Justice Sanjiv Khanna and Mr. Justice S.V.N. Bhatti

Add. Info:

Impugned Order: (2023) ibclaw.in 569 NCLAT

Corporate Debtor: Regen Powertech Pvt. Ltd. and Regen Infrastructure and Services Pvt. Ltd.


Judgment/Order:

O R D E R

We are of the opinion that in view of the facts and circumstances, the Resolution Professional should not have filed the present appeals. The Resolution Professional should have maintained a neutral stand. It is for the aggrieved parties, including the Committee of Creditors of Regen Powertech Private Limited (RPPL) and Regen Infrastructure and Services Private Limited (RISPL), to take appropriate proceedings or file an appeal before this Court.

Recording the aforesaid, the present appeals preferred by the Resolution Professional are dismissed as not entertained.

If required and necessary, the Court can take assistance and ascertain the facts from the Resolution Professional, in case an appeal(s) is preferred by the Committee of Creditors or a third party.

Pending application(s), if any, shall stand disposed of.
